JOEY Sherway is a verified Etobicoke venue with daily hours that begin at 11 AM and run late: until 12 AM from Sunday through Thursday, until 1 AM on Friday and Saturday. The verified dress code is smart casual, which makes it straightforward to plan for without treating the night as formal.

How it compares in Etobicoke
JOEY Sherway is the easiest recommendation for a mixed group near Sherway Gardens because it asks the least of the planner. Via Allegro Ristorante is the better fit for a more formal dinner, especially if the room and pacing matter more than flexibility. JOEY is the more casual, lower-commitment choice.
Against Jack's Sherway, the decision comes down to mood: choose JOEY for a more polished chain-restaurant feel, Jack's Sherway for a looser sports-bar-adjacent meal. Royal Meats BarBeque is the better call when the group wants a meat-focused, casual meal rather than a broad all-purpose menu.
Sushi Kaji is the specialist pick for sushi and a more intentional dining plan, while Bonimi is the stronger alternative for diners who want something more local in feel. JOEY wins on ease and versatility; the peers win when the occasion has a clearer food brief.
